Catholic Outreach Program invites Ohio Museum Director for Religious Art Talk

CANTON REPOSITORY

OHIO — M.J. Albacete, executive director of the Canton Museum of Art, will give a presentation on 13 significant works of religious art at 7 p.m. Oct. 13 at St. Michael the Archangel Catholic Church at 3430 St. Michael Drive NW. The program is part of an arts outreach sponsored by the Catholic Adult Formation and Education Committee. It includes a current exhibit of 40 art pieces done by St. Michael parishioners. [link]
